Digital rights, privacy, and government policies have been a hot topic over the past month as the Trump Administration comes on board. But the truth is, data protection and safeguarding our freedoms are not partisan issues. Regardless of what party is in power, we need to be vigilant about our digital rights and never give up the fight to protect them.
Cindy Cohn, Executive Director of The Electronic Frontier Foundation, discusses the evolving landscape of digital rights, privacy, and government policies impacting technology. With a career dedicated to defending civil liberties in the digital age, Cindy shares insights on encryption, AI governance, surveillance capitalism, and the role of regulatory frameworks in shaping the future of the internet.
Key Takeaways:
(03:16) Cindy’s path to digital rights advocacy and the influence of early internet pioneers.
(07:08) The Electronic Frontier Foundation’s mission to protect civil liberties online.
(12:52) The dangers of surveillance capitalism and the need for privacy-first regulations.
(19:51) Tensions between big tech CEOs and their workforces over privacy and ethics.
(22:23) The implications of government funding cuts on internet privacy tools.
(29:58) The challenges of aligning US and international digital policies.
(32:29) Continuing privacy challenges regardless of different administrations.
(43:21) The need for comprehensive privacy protections so users can enjoy technology without surveillance risks.
